Dell SupportAssist for Home PCs (version 3.11.4 and prior) and SupportAssist for Business PCs (version 3.2.0 and prior) contain a privilege escalation vulnerability. A local authenticated malicious user could potentially exploit this vulnerability to elevate privileges and gain total control of the system.

Dell SupportAssist contains a local privilege escalation vulnerability allowing an authenticated user to gain SYSTEM-level or full administrative control of the affected Windows system. The vulnerability exists in versions 3.11.4 and prior for Home PCs and 3.2.0 and prior for Business PCs.

MitigationUpdate to a patched version of Dell SupportAssist if available; otherwise, remove or disable the software until a patch can be applied.

Work through these to decide whether this CVE applies to you.

  1. Confirm Dell SupportAssist is installed
    Open Programs and Features in Control Panel or use 'Get-ItemProperty' in PowerShell to query the registry under HKLM:\Software\Microsoft\Windows\CurrentVersion\Uninstall for entries containing 'SupportAssist', or run 'wmic product get name,version' to list installed software.
    Affected if Dell SupportAssist is not present on the system, the vulnerability does not apply.
  2. Identify the SupportAssist variant
    Review the software name in Programs and Features or the uninstall registry entry. Look for 'Dell SupportAssist for Business PCs' or 'Dell SupportAssist for Home PCs' in the displayed name.
    Affected if The variant must be identified to apply the correct version threshold.
  3. Retrieve the installed version number
    In Programs and Features, note the version column for the SupportAssist entry. Alternatively, run 'wmic product where "name like '%SupportAssist%'" get name,version' or check the Uninstall registry key for the Version value.
    Affected if The version number is required to determine if it falls within the affected range.
  4. Compare version against affected ranges
    For Business PCs: check if version is <= 3.2.0. For Home PCs: check if version is <= 3.11.4. If the exact version cannot be determined, inspect the program's About or Help section within the application.
    Affected if Version <= 3.2.0 for Business PCs or <= 3.11.4 for Home PCs indicates the system is affected by this privilege escalation vulnerability.

The system is affected if Dell SupportAssist is installed and the installed version falls within the vulnerable ranges (3.2.0 and prior for Business PCs, 3.11.4 and prior for Home PCs).
